Using information about your income and expenses, you should be able to create a budget. Start with figuring out how much income is brought home after taxes per month. Make sure to include all income streams, such as extra part-time work or income from a rental property. Create a budget, so that what you spend each month isn't more than how much you make.

Also, it is important to have a budget. Compile a detailed list that shows where the money goes. This should include regular bills, groceries, clothing and entertainment expenses. Be sure to include what your spouse spends as well. Be sure to include bills that are paid less frequently than once a month. Make sure the list doesn't leave anything out, lest the financial picture it paints be incomplete.

Once you have determined your precise income, it will be simple to plan your budget. You can draw up a similar list of your expenses and assess each one for savings potential. One way to save money is to stay home and cook. Be creative as you review your expenditures and try to find ways to spend less and save more.

You can see a reduction in utility costs by replacing your standard water heater with a tankless or "on-demand" model. Additionally, you should also take a look at the owners' manual of your dishwasher and other appliances to ensure that you are using them in the proper manner. To keep your water bill at the lowest cost, be sure to fix any damaged pipes immediately.

Consider buying energy efficient appliances in your home. This will end up saving you a lot more money over time, as your energy saving appliances will help cut down on your utility bills. Get in the habit of unplugging ghost electronics that suck money out of your wallet each month.

Check your insulation and roof to make sure that damages are not tempering with the efficiency of your heating and cooling systems. These upgrades are a sure-fire way to significantly lower your utility bills.
